文件名称:KubeZephyr-Backend:该项目是基于fastapi和mongodb的KubeZephyr后端。 它可以通过Web API操作Kubernetes资源
文件大小:113KB
文件格式:ZIP
更新时间:2024-04-18 20:21:09
kubernetes mongodb fastapi Python
KubeZephyr后端 做什么的 该项目是基于fastapi + mongodb的KubeZephyr后端。 它可以通过Web API操作kubernetes资源。 快速开始 克隆git repo并运行pip3 install git clone https://github.com/zephyrxvxx7/KubeZephyr-Backend.git cd kubezephyr-backend pip3 install -f requirements.txt 然后在项目根目录中创建.env文件,并为应用程序设置环境变量: touch .env echo " PROJECT_NAME=KubeZephyr " >> .env echo DATABASE_URL=mongo:// $MONGO_USER : $MONGO_PASSWORD @ $MONGO_HOST : $MONGO
【文件预览】:
KubeZephyr-Backend-master
----.gitignore(1KB)
----Dockerfile(210B)
----app()
--------api()
--------core()
--------__init__.py(0B)
--------db()
--------models()
--------kubernetes()
--------main.py(2KB)
--------crud()
----requirements.txt(146B)
----build_docker.sh(43B)
----.dockerignore(119B)
----run_docker.sh(141B)
----docker-compose.yml(277B)
----README.md(2KB)
----start_server.py(145B)